微软的C和sun的java,两种语言使用起来各有什么优点啊,编程风格哪个更好呢?

我觉得我被微软影响大了,之前学习的C我学得很好很有感觉,java只学一年,后面的知识我很难理解,摸不懂它的编程风格,而C的后面知识我能理解。问了些人都说java好,它是主... 我觉得我被微软影响大了,之前学习的C我学得很好很有感觉,java只学一年,后面的知识我很难理解,摸不懂它的编程风格,而C的后面知识我能理解。问了些人都说java好,它是主流,可我用起来麻烦呀,这C和java各有哪些优点啊?现在工作偏偏跟java有关,所以我才问下,顺便想知道下java的编程思维。
果然有大牛啊,我错了,C语言一直是微软用,我没考究这历史,今天见识了。我是懂点算法、语法。
展开
 我来答
cxl1314cjw
2012-01-08 · TA获得超过1074个赞
知道小有建树答主
回答量:776
采纳率:100%
帮助的人:465万
展开全部
微软开发C#编程语言可视化方面强一些,就是可视化操作简单些,而java很多地方都需要自己去编写代码,所以你就感觉难,一般情况下微软的产品都是通俗易懂,图形界面操作,基本使用两种语言都可以满足,据听说大型项目,java语言编写对程序的安全性比较好。
ismartbug
2012-01-08 · TA获得超过740个赞
知道小有建树答主
回答量:152
采纳率:100%
帮助的人:137万
展开全部
c是面向过程的,java是面向对象的。如果你要用C语言吃饭,那确实要牛一点,做底层开发,比如操作系统的内核那种,大型软件的内核,这些是基于效率的。

你到公司里做程序员的话,java确实是算主流的,还有c#、C++都是面向对象的,可以说是一类,学会3着之一,其他的2门就很好理解或者说没多大区别,java比较庞大,框架就有N多,但你必须会,要学个2、3年才能对java真正有点了解,吃透的话不好说。
我也在学习java 所以纯属愚见,望各位大牛不要喷啊
本回答被提问者采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
le284
2012-01-08 · 还没有填写任何签名呢
le284
采纳数:315 获赞数:996

向TA提问 私信TA
展开全部
首先,你的c指定不怎么样,只知道基本的语法而已! 因为你居然说C是微软的,说出去会被人笑话的。
c是面向过程的,所以它的思维很好理解,就是我们解决一件事的过程,你用语言描述即可,可是对于一个大一点的工程,其开发难度就会很大。你学的c只是皮毛而已
java是面向对象的。也就是我们在编程时需要抽象出它的对象,理解它的框架。所以java只要上手就会比较容易,对于大的工程也便于扩展。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
d7011800
2012-01-08
知道答主
回答量:25
采纳率:0%
帮助的人:6万
展开全部
java是面向对象的, 只要抽事物的特性和之间的联系就行, 而且java分层很明确, 而且很严格...总的来说java更加适合人的思维方式, 而且更容易上手
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
xuesong9658
2012-01-09 · 超过12用户采纳过TA的回答
知道答主
回答量:108
采纳率:0%
帮助的人:25.5万
展开全部
java后面是各种框架
C我没学过 不过好涉及算法
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(3)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式